Detailed Description:

– OpenAI has launched GPT-5, which has been met with mixed reviews, prompting the restoration of the previous model, GPT-4, for some users.
– GPT-5 is designed to capture the enterprise market, an area where its competitor, Anthropic, has made notable advances.
– Early feedback from startups indicates that GPT-5 is being adopted for its efficient setup, competitive pricing, and capability in handling complex tasks.
– Enterprise companies, such as Box, have reported positive experiences with GPT-5, especially in processing long, logic-heavy documents, and have praised its superior reasoning abilities.
– OpenAI is incurring significant expenses to maintain its competitive edge over Anthropic, reportedly on pace to spend $8 billion this year in pursuit of customer retention and market dominance.
– GPT-5’s pricing is much lower than Anthropic’s top model, creating a financial incentive for businesses to adopt it.
– The demand for GPT-5’s API has surged, with marked increases in coding and reasoning tasks being reported.
– The model’s efficacy has been acknowledged in catching coding mistakes, including security-related bugs, indicating its potential for enhancing software security practices.
– Despite OpenAI’s advancements, Anthropic is similarly thriving with substantial revenue growth.
